Description including Unit Aims

Students will complete a dissertation on a topic of their choice (subject to staff competence) in their final year. In the March of Year 2 students begin considering the topic for their dissertation, and before the summer vacation of the same academic year, are allocated a supervisor. The supervisor will hold regular meetings with the student to discuss the progress of the dissertation. The dissertation would be submitted in the May of the student's final academic year.
